HORIZON YACHTS TO SHOWCASE FOUR FD SERIES SUPERYACHTS

by admin

Horizon Yachts is planning a showcase of newly launched yachts for the 2023 Fort Lauderdale International Boat Show

Four brand new Horizon yachts including an FD110 Tri-Deck, an FD100 Tri-Deck, an FD90 and an FD75 will be on display at the Horizon Yacht USA stand at this year’s Fort Lauderdale show.

The new tri-deck FD110, Crowned Eagle will make her presence known with her towering tri-deck, beamy profile and spacious beach club.  Positioned forward on the lower deck instead of the traditional aft location, the crew area aboard Crowned Eagle includes a large mess and three ensuite cabins. In addition to a private crew staircase that accesses the galley directly above, a companionway leads to the guest accommodations foyer aft for ease of service.

The ensuite guest staterooms on this level are spacious in their own right, with three queen and a convertible twin branching off of a wide hallway highlighted by a backlit feather etching in the aft bulkhead. 

Another new build for a repeat Horizon owner, the ninth hull of the FD100 Tri-Deck model will also be on display. This yacht features an on-deck master stateroom and four ensuite cabins on the lower deck, with private quarters for six crew members aft. Boasting a spacious interior with plentiful natural light for which the high volume FD Series design is renown, the FD100 features an inviting main salon, formal dining area, large galley with Hi/Lo privacy partition and a full beam master stateroom on the main deck. This yacht also features an enclosed skylounge with a large u-shaped seating area and formal dining table for ten on the boat deck, bow seating with a sunpad on the foredeck, and additional sunpads, a wet bar and a Jacuzzi tub on the tri-deck.

The first of two brand new inventory yachts on display, the FD90 Skyline features the enviable split-use skylounge. This is the first FD90 model to be designed with this configuration, which features an enclosed skylounge and traditional open boat deck area aft, as well as a covered area in between with an L-shaped sofa and full bar that allows for entertaining and relaxing in the open area. The yacht offers a four-stateroom layout, including a master suite on the main deck and mirrored VIP staterooms to port and starboard on the lower deck as well as a forward VIP in the bow. An open galley on the main deck is another first for this model while the use of washed wenge as the main wood material creates a calm and sophisticated atmosphere, with contrasting. Another unique layout feature of this FD90 is the lower deck laundry room, which doubles as a short-stay cabin and includes its own head and Pullman berth.  Rounding out the Horizon Yachts showcase, the popular FD75 model is exemplified by the ninth hull in the series. The latest FD75 features a raised pilothouse design with an open flybridge with a dayhead and a four-stateroom layout that includes an on-deck master stateroom. The galley is situated aft to maximize  indoor/outdoor living.
